Skip to content
Snippets Groups Projects
Commit e5cb05d1 authored by Danae Savvidi's avatar Danae Savvidi :laughing:
Browse files

create course works!

parent 3e8102d8
Branches
No related tags found
1 merge request!5Resolve "Connect to CORE"
Pipeline #958435 failed
......@@ -86,10 +86,12 @@ public class CourseController {
GroupParams groupParams = gitlabGroupAPIService.buildGroupParams(course).withName(courseDetails.getName());
GitbullCourse gitbullCourse = GitbullCourse.builder().id(courseId).coursePath(course.getPath()).build();
courseService.addGitbullCourse(gitbullCourse);
Group gitlabGroup = gitlabGroupAPIService.updateGitlabGroup(gitLabApi, course.getPath(), groupParams);
gitlabGroupAPIService.createGitlabGroup(gitLabApi, groupParams);
model.addAttribute("coreCourse", courseDetails);
model.addAttribute("gitlabCourse", gitlabGroup);
model.addAttribute("courses", courseService.getManagingCourses(person.getId()));
model.addAttribute("course", GitlabGroupDTO.builder().build());
model.addAttribute("edition", GitlabGroupDTO.builder().build());
model.addAttribute("teacher", TeacherCourseRequestDTO.builder().build());
return "course/create";
// return "redirect:/course/" + id;
}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please to comment